DATA PRACTICE

See how our Legal policy handles records

The policy explains what we keep, why we use it and how you can ask about a record connected to your account.

Account details

We use your registered phone number and account details to identify the correct account, complete phone verification and respond to policy requests. Keep these details current; sending a password or one-time code to support is not required for a normal Legal enquiry.

Payment matching

A DANA, OVO, GoPay or QRIS receipt can contain a reference used to match a wallet event with your account. For bank transfer or virtual account records, we may compare the submitted reference with the account name and transaction details before replying.

Cookie choices

Cookies can help remember session settings and support account navigation. Our Legal policy explains their purpose and the choices available in your browser. Clearing cookies may require you to verify your phone again when you return to the account area.

Account security

Phone verification is required before account access where the policy calls for it. If your device changes or a sign-in pattern needs checking, we may ask for account details rather than a password. Never share a one-time code in a support message.

Record retention

We retain account, payment and support records for the period described in our Legal policy, including when a transaction or access question needs a trace. The retention period can differ by record type and applicable local requirements.

Policy changes

When a Legal term changes, we publish the revised wording on this policy page and identify the effective date where needed. Check this page before using DANA, QRIS or another payment route if you have not visited your account recently.
